A 1997 GT-R for that price sounds like it has either been beat to sh.t or is a scam. Most R33's sell for between $10k-$20K over here, in decent condtion. I'd be leary of it unless it's on U.S. soil.

And even though it is a year for eligble import, be sure that all the modifications can be done. You need to get the ECU to be OBD II compatible, and to the best of my knowledge, it hasn't been done yet. Plus, you are going to pay more than what you paid for the car to get it legal.
